+/**
+ * Builds Accumulo scan specifications from Drill filter expressions.
+ *
+ * <p>This class converts Drill's LogicalExpression filter representation into
+ * Accumulo scan parameters (start row, stop row). It focuses on row key
+ * predicates since those can be efficiently pushed down to Accumulo's scan
range.</p>
+ *
+ * <p>Supported predicates on row_key:</p>
+ * <ul>
+ * <li>row_key = 'value' → exact range</li>
+ * <li>row_key > 'value' → start row (exclusive)</li>
+ * <li>row_key >= 'value' → start row (inclusive)</li>
+ * <li>row_key < 'value' → stop row (exclusive)</li>
+ * <li>row_key <= 'value' → stop row (inclusive)</li>
+ * <li>AND combinations → intersect ranges</li>
+ * <li>OR combinations → union ranges (if contiguous)</li>
+ * </ul>
+ */

Review Comment:
Good catch, this was a real correctness bug. The union of the two ranges is
a superset of the disjunction, but the builder still reported
`allExpressionsConverted == true`, so `AccumuloPushFilterIntoScan` dropped the
filter and the scan returned everything between 'a' and 'z'.
Fixed in a7b5c66: an OR merge now sets `allExpressionsConverted = false`, so
the range still narrows the scan but the Drill filter stays in the plan to
discard the rows in between.
While in there I also fixed a second bug in the same path: the OR union used
the AND helpers, which treat a null bound as "take the other side" rather than
"unbounded". That made `row_key < 'x' OR row_key > 'y'` collapse into an
inverted range. Union now propagates null (unbounded).
Added two integration tests for this — `testFilterOnRowKeyDisjunction` and
`testFilterOnRowKeyDisjunctionOfRanges`. Both fail on the old code (the first
returned 9 rows instead of 2) and pass now.
